CAS 89552-65-8
:3,17-Dioxa-10-thia-4,16-disilanonadecane, 4,4,16,16-tetraethoxy-
Description:
3,17-Dioxa-10-thia-4,16-disilanonadecane, 4,4,16,16-tetraethoxy- is a complex organosilicon compound characterized by its unique structure, which includes multiple silicon (Si) atoms, oxygen (O) atoms, and sulfur (S) atoms. The presence of ethoxy groups contributes to its solubility and reactivity, making it useful in various chemical applications. This compound likely exhibits properties typical of organosilicon compounds, such as thermal stability and resistance to moisture. Its molecular structure suggests potential applications in materials science, particularly in the development of coatings, adhesives, or as intermediates in organic synthesis. The presence of both sulfur and silicon may also impart unique electronic or catalytic properties, which could be explored in specialized chemical reactions. However, specific physical properties such as boiling point, melting point, and solubility would require empirical data for precise characterization. As with many organosilicon compounds, safety and handling precautions should be observed due to potential reactivity and toxicity.
Formula:C22H50O6SSi2
